The Guardian Alliance Network (G.A.N.) is a network of alerts based on the real-time feedback of all you Guardians. When an event is reported, G.A.N. automatically will relay the notification to all the other Guardians.
1Reliability Level The more reports we get, the more reliable is the public event.
2Time since the public event has been reported.
3G.A.N. Status Icon.
NOTE: The Legendary Edition increases the refresh rate of G.A.N. Network Events to give you even more fresh, real time events.
The Settings Section allows you to adjust some options like:
Disable Display Sleep Usually the idle timer dims the screen and eventually puts the device to sleep when no user activity occurs (e.g. screen touches). Set to ON to disable the idle timer and avert system sleep.
Mute Alert Sound When an event is spawning aon alert sound will play. Set to ON to disable the alert sound.
G.A.N. Filter Set the minimum reliability level threshold of G.A.N. Alerts. Select this setting if you would like to be alerted only for Medium or High reliability G.A.N. Events.
Event Database Events for Destiny automatically update its event database every day. If you would like to force the update you can tap on the Force Update button in the Event Database panel.
